The Real Reasons NCIS: Hawai‘i Might Be at Risk

Ratings Fluctuations Raise Questions

While NCIS: Hawai‘i performs solidly, it’s not the top-rated show on CBS. Networks often prioritize heavy hitters, and any dip in ratings can trigger an internal review.

Production Costs in Hawai‘i

Filming in Hawai‘i offers stunning visuals, but it comes with a higher budget. When a network balances cost versus performance, expensive shows naturally sit under the microscope.

The Future of the NCIS Franchise Itself

With the franchise expanding—new spinoffs, returning classics, and potential international series—CBS may be assessing long-term strategy.
